Linux系统管理必备:常用命令详解

需积分: 10 2 下载量 115 浏览量 更新于2024-09-11 收藏 4KB TXT 举报
"这篇文档是关于Linux操作系统的常用命令汇总,涵盖了查看系统信息、安装管理、进程监控等多个方面的内容。" 在Linux系统中,掌握一些基本的命令行操作是至关重要的,以下是一些常见的Linux命令及其用途: 1. `net use`:用于创建、删除或显示网络连接。例如,`net use \\IP\ipc$/user:administrator password` 可以用来建立到指定IP的IPC连接,但注意这里没有提供实际的用户名和密码。 2. `RemoteRegistryService`:这是一个Windows服务,允许远程访问注册表。在Linux中,通常使用其他工具来管理远程系统。 3. `kill -9 PID`:这个命令用于强制结束一个进程,其中PID是进程的ID号。`-9` 参数表示立即结束,不给予进程任何清理的机会。 4. `apachectl -v`:显示Apache HTTP服务器的版本信息,用于确认正在使用的Apache版本。 5. `nohup ./startserver.sh &`:在后台启动脚本`startserver.sh`,并且在用户退出终端后仍能继续运行。 6. `service oscardb_OSRDBd status`:查看名为oscardb_OSRDBd的服务状态,这通常用于管理系统服务的启动、停止和状态检查。 7. `cat /proc/cpuinfo | grep MHz | uniq`:查看CPU的频率信息,`uniq` 命令用于去除重复项。 8. `uname -a`:显示系统的基本信息,包括内核版本、硬件平台等。 9. `cat /etc/issue | grep Linux`:显示操作系统发行版的详细信息。 10. `cat /proc/cpuinfo | grep physicalid | uniq -c`:统计物理CPU的数量,`-c` 参数用于计数。 11. `cat /proc/meminfo | grep MemTotal`:查看系统的总内存大小。 12. `fdisk -l | grep Disk`:列出所有磁盘信息,包括它们的大小和分区情况。 13. 监测CPU利用率: - `cat /proc/cpuinfo | grep "processor"| wc -l`:显示CPU的核心总数。 - `cat /proc/cpuinfo | grep "physicalid"| sort | uniq | wc -l`:统计物理CPU的数量。 - `cat /proc/cpuinfo | grep "cpucores"| wc -l`:显示每个物理CPU上的核心数。 - `cat /proc/cpuinfo | grep MHz`:查看CPU的时钟速度。 14. `ps -ef | grep java`:列出所有正在运行的Java进程,用于排查Java程序的状态。 15. 系统监控: - `top`:实时显示系统总体信息,包括CPU和内存使用情况。 - `vmstat -n 5`:每5秒显示一次虚拟内存统计信息。 - `iostat -n 6`:每6秒显示一次I/O设备使用情况,对于分析硬盘性能非常有用。 以上就是Linux系统中的一些常用命令,它们可以帮助我们有效地管理和监控系统,提升日常运维的效率。在使用过程中,根据具体需求,可以结合其他参数或工具进行更深入的操作。